The Heart of San Miguel: Relax and Enjoy El Jardín Guide
El Jardín, officially known as the Plaza Principal, is the central square and the vibrant heart of San Miguel de Allende. This picturesque plaza is a gathering place for locals and tourists alike, offering a perfect spot to relax, people-watch, and soak in the atmosphere of this charming colonial city. Surrounded by historic buildings, including the iconic Parroquia de San Miguel Arcángel, El Jardín is a must-see destination. El Jardín has been the focal point of San Miguel de Allende since its founding in the 16th century. Over the centuries, it has served as a marketplace, a parade ground, and a social hub. The current layout, with its manicured gardens, wrought-iron benches, and central bandstand, reflects a more modern design, but the plaza retains its historical significance as the center of community life. At El Jardín, you can simply relax on a bench and enjoy the scenery, listen to live music performed at the bandstand, or browse the stalls of local vendors selling crafts and souvenirs. The plaza is also surrounded by cafes and restaurants, offering a variety of dining options. San Miguel de Allende is known for its diverse culinary scene, blending traditional Mexican flavors with international influences. Around El Jardín, you'll find everything from street tacos to upscale dining experiences. Be sure to try local specialties like enchiladas mineras or a refreshing agua fresca.
Transportation
El Jardín is located in the very center of San Miguel de Allende and is easily accessible on foot from almost anywhere in the historic center. Most local buses also pass through or near El Jardín, making it a convenient transportation hub.
